Vandals Caught With 35,000 Jerry Cans Of Fuel


Detectives, at the Zone 2 Police Command, Onikan, Lagos, have arrested three men who vandalise petroleum pipelines and siphon fuel at Ilase village, in Lagos state.

Those arrested include Tajudeen Bello, a resident of Ilase village, and the ‘engineer' who drills holes in the pipelines. Others are Tunde Akindele, who resides at Ibode village, and Saidu Jinadu, their 56-year-old security man, who keeps watch for them while they perpetrate their crime. He resides at Okun Agun area of Ilase village.

The suspects were arrested with two thousand 50-litre jerry cans and a trailer loaded with 33,000 jerry cans. The jerry cans and the trailer were impounded and handed over to the NNPC management at Atlas Cove, Apapa.

In his confession to the police, the ring leader, Tajudeen Bello, confessed that they had been in the business for long. 'We have been arrested several times by the police, but we normally bribe our way out. Now that our instruments have been seized by the police, I promise to change and look for a decent job.' The suspects are currently being detained at Zone 2 Police Command, Onikan, Lagos.
